Most manufacturers use China for part or all of their PSU production and it triggered the 10% tariffs for imports to the US. Seasonic was up front about having to jack up their prices to cover the additional costs. It was supposed to move up to 25% late last year, but that's being pushed back. I can't seem to find anything on whether the new trade deal drops them (and would businesses with a strong demand market drop prices or just keep them where they are for extra profit?).
With the Corona virus completely shutting down parts of China and possible similar issues in other countries, we are probably on the verge of a supply failure for many parts.
